Find the relevant period:-. Take the last normal payday on or before the end of the Qualifying Week. (If you have already given birth by then, take the last normal payday before the week of birth). That normal payday is the last day of the relevant period. Count back 8 weeks from that day.
Web11 Aug 2024 · You can work under your contract of service for the employer paying you SMP for up to 10 days during your MPP without losing any SMP. Hours worked during a keeping-in-touch day Any work undertaken on a day during your maternity leave period will count as a whole keeping-in-touch day, regardless of the number of hours you attend work. Will I lose Maternity Allowance if I work for more than ten KIT days? Maternity Allowance (MA) is paid by the Department for Work and Pensions (DWP) to women who do not qualify for Statutory Maternity Pay or who are self-employed. You don't have to repay it if you decide not to return to work. Once you have qualified for SMP your employer must pay it to you even if you leave employment with them. KIT days (keeping in touch days): during maternity leave, an employee may attend work for up to 10 “keeping in touch” days without being deemed to bring her maternity leave to an end.
